WordPress ・Xserverでhttps化する方法

①Wordpress管理画面 と ②Xserverのサーバー管理(サーバーパネル)の両方で修正が必要です。
一番注意すべきは順番です。
①Wordpress管理画面側の修正を先にやる。
②Xserveerのサーバー管理の修正を先にやってしまうと、
最近のブラウザはhttpからhttpsにリダイレクトされる設定を保存するので、URL設定がhttpのままのWordpress管理画面にアクセスできなくなってしまいます。

スポンサーリンク

リダイレクトされる設定を削除することもできると思いますが、難易度が高い(調べたが方法わからなかった)

それでは修正方法です。

①Wordpress管理画面の修正
簡単です。管理画面の左側のペインの「設定」→「一般」にあるサイトアドレス(URL)のhttpをhttpsに変えるだけです。
WordPress アドレス (URL)は変更する必要はありません。

②Xserverのサーバー管理(サーバーパネル)
②-1「ドメイン→SSL設定」をオンにする。無料独自SSL設定。反映は1-2分で終わります。

②-2「ホームページ→.httaccessの編集」
下図の黄色の枠のように一番上に以下のコードを追加し「確認画面へ進む→実行する」

RewriteEngine On
RewriteCond %{HTTPS} !on
R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]

以上です。

[出典]
②-1 https://www.xserver.ne.jp/manual/man_server_ssl.php
②-2 https://www.xserver.ne.jp/manual/man_server_fullssl.php

広告1
スポンサードリンク

シェアする

  • このエントリーをはてなブックマークに追加

フォローする